Memory Café
Memory Cafés provide a social and resource place for people living with memory loss and their care partners. Caregivers participate in an educational and/or support session while people with memory loss actively participate in a cognitive engagement program.
Advanced Directives
Advance care planning is a facilitated process of planning for future health and personal care. Advance directives guide future decision-making at a time when a person is unable to make their wishes known to their healthcare team. Carla Sutter, MSW, of the Arizona Healthcare Directives Registry will help you design a plan that honors your end-of-life healthcare wishes.

Caring Connections
Caring Connections is a monthly support group for couples to attend together—where one partner is living with Mild Cognitive Impairment or Early-Stage Dementia. The focus is on staying connected, sharing joys and challenges, and receiving support to navigate the journey as a team. Each session includes social time, brain-healthy snacks, activities, and both emotional and practical support.
